  • 1. The skogsrå are female spirits of the forest, portrayed as sirens luring men to them or as guardians of the forest.
  • 2. The neck are water spirits of the Germanic folklore
  • 3. The polska is a family of Scandinavian music and dance forms. A poem from 1812 by Arvid August Afzelius is titled "Näcken" ("The neck") and is also known by the name "Näckens polska" ("The polska of the neck").
